+Navigating the Secondary Glazing Consultation: A Comprehensive Guide for Property Owners
For lots of home owners, particularly those living in historical, listed, or sanctuary structures, the obstacle of maintaining thermal effectiveness and sound insulation is a constant battle. While contemporary double glazing is typically the go-to option for contemporary builds, it is frequently restricted or unwanted for heritage properties due to visual or planning constraints. This is where secondary glazing works as a perfect intervention.
However, moving from the idea of secondary glazing to an ended up installation requires an important very first action: the expert consultation. A secondary glazing consultation is a technical assessment designed to bridge the gap between architectural preservation and modern convenience. This post checks out the complexities of the assessment procedure, what residential or commercial property owners ought to expect, and how professional advice makes sure an effective setup.
The Importance of a Professional Technical Consultation
Secondary glazing involves the installation of a discreet internal window frame, fitted to the space side of existing primary windows. Due to the fact that every period home features special structural subtleties-- such as unequal stone surrounds or splayed exposes-- a "one-size-fits-all" technique is hardly ever successful.
An expert assessment serves a number of main functions:

The consultation is generally divided into 3 unique phases: the initial discovery, the technical survey, and the design recommendation.
1. The Initial Discovery and Needs Analysis
The procedure begins with a discussion relating to the particular concerns the homeowner is aiming to fix. In many metropolitan environments, "acoustic dampening" is the top priority. In rural places or exposed coastal locations, "thermal retention" and "draft exclusion" often take precedence.
2. The Detailed Technical Survey
As soon as objectives are developed, a property surveyor carries out a careful measurement of every window. This is not merely a measurement of height and width; it includes looking for "out-of-square" frames and measuring the "gap" or "air cavity" in between the main and [Secondary Glazing Benefits](http://bbs.51pinzhi.cn/home.php?mod=space&uid=7768128) glass. The size of this cavity is important for performance.

Throughout the consultation, technical specialists will discuss the "physics" of the setup. For those aiming to substantially decrease sound or heat loss, the list below elements are non-negotiable:
Acoustic Insulation (Noise Reduction)To accomplish maximum noise decrease (typically as much as 80% or 50dB), an assessment will recommend a specific air cavity. Ideally, a space of 100mm to 200mm in between the primary and secondary glass is needed to decouple the sound vibrations. Using acoustic laminated glass even more boosts this impact.
Thermal Efficiency (Heat Retention)For thermal enhancements, the gap is typically smaller sized (approx. 20mm to 80mm) to reduce air convection. Specialists frequently recommend Low-E (Low Emissivity) glass, which features a microscopic coating designed to show heat back into the room.

Homeowner should be prepared for a surveyor to examine the list below aspects throughout the visit:
Reveal Depth: Is there enough space on the window sill or "reveal" to mount the secondary frame without striking manages or window stays?Structural Integrity: Is the wood or stone around the window free from rot or considerable crumbling?Positioning: Does the main window have "satisfying rails" (horizontal bars) that the [Secondary Glazing Bespoke Solutions](https://notes.bmcs.one/s/5cLkva-xjq) glazing should line up with to remain undetectable from the street?Functionality: Does the window need to serve as an emergency exit? This determines the kind of locking system and opening style needed.Condensation Management: The property surveyor will examine for existing wet problems. Secondary glazing can often assist reduce condensation if defined with timed ventilation or trickle vents.Conservation and Listed Building Requirements
One of the best advantages discussed throughout an assessment is the status of secondary glazing in the eyes of regional planning authorities. Since it is an internal, "reversible" adjustment, it is generally considered "Permitted Development."
However, the assessment will validate if the proposed frames are "ultra-slim" or if the color-matching (RAL powder covering) is enough to satisfy the visual requirements of a Grade II noted property. This professional sign-off supplies assurance that the property's heritage worth is being safeguarded instead of compromised.

Just how much space is needed for the setup?Generally, a minimum of 50mm of "reveal" (the flat area on the window frame or wall) is required. If the reveals are shallow, sub-frames can be utilized to extend the installing surface.
Can secondary glazing be colored to match existing decoration?Yes. Modern secondary glazing frames are made from aluminum and can be powder-coated in any RAL color. This permits them to blend in with either the internal wall color or the original window frames.
